Commercial Slab Installation in Sarasota, FL
Commercial slab installation services involve the placement of concrete foundations that support various types of structures such as warehouses, retail spaces, parking areas, and industrial facilities. This service typically includes site preparation, formwork, reinforcement, and the pouring and finishing of concrete slabs designed to meet specific load requirements and building codes. Property owners interested in this service should understand the importance of proper soil assessment, drainage considerations, and the need for durable, level surfaces to ensure long-term stability and safety for their commercial projects.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ners often want to clarify project scope, including size, thickness, and any special reinforcement needs. It is also helpful to consider factors like access for heavy equipment, potential permits, and how the slab will integrate with other construction elements. Ensuring clear communication about these details can help facilitate a smooth process and a finished surface that meets the functional demands of the intended use.

Common Commercial Slab Installation Jobs
Commercial slab installation involves preparing and pouring concrete slabs for various business and industrial structures.
Foundation slabs provide a stable base for warehouses, retail stores, and manufacturing facilities.
Parking lot slabs create durable surfaces for vehicle parking and access points.
Sidewalk and walkway slabs enhance safety and accessibility around commercial properties.
Loading dock slabs are designed to withstand heavy equipment and frequent traffic.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require commercial slab installation? Commercial slab installation is often needed for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on commercial properties in Sarasota and nearby areas.
What is the purpose of a concrete slab in commercial settings? A concrete slab provides a stable, level surface that supports heavy equipment, vehicles, and foot traffic, ensuring durability and safety for commercial operations.
How does site preparation affect slab installation? Proper site preparation, including grading and soil compaction, helps prevent future cracking and shifting, ensuring the longevity of the slab.
What materials are commonly used for commercial slabs? Reinforced concrete is typically used for commercial slabs due to its strength, durability, and ability to withstand heavy loads.
